The Radio Télévision Suisse (; "Swiss Radio Television"), shortened to RTS, is a subsidiary of the Swiss Broadcasting Corporation (SRG SSR), operating in French-speaking Switzerland. It was created on 1 January 2010 by a merger of Radio Suisse Romande (RSR) and Télévision Suisse Romande (TSR).

Broadcasting


Radio

Radio Suisse Romande (RSR) is the area of RTS in charge of production and broadcasting of radio programming in French for Switzerland: * RTS Première – general programming * RTS Espace 2 – cultural and intellectual programming; classical and jazz music * RTS Couleur 3 – youth programming * RTS Option Musique – music and variety programming


Television

Télévision Suisse Romande (TSR) is the area of RTS in charge of production and distribution of television programming in French for Switzerland: * RTS 1 * RTS 2 * RTS Info
